Tuskegee National Forest

– Taska. U.S. Hwy. 80, 5.5 mi./8.85 km east of Tuskegee. Replica of Booker T. Washington’s childhood cabin on site. Picnic area with BBQ grills.

– Bartram National Recreation Trail. 8-mi./13-km hiking and bicycling trail.
